Start by y-k=m(x-h)
m= 3
k=2
h=1
so y-2=3(x-1)
distribute
y=3x-3+2
final answer: y=3x-1

Suppose there are n observations in a data set consisting of the observations x1, x2, x3, ..., xn.
Rounding rule: round to one more decimal place than the highest number of decimal places contained in the data.
The formula can also be represented as sigma * xi / n.
x bar = SAMPLE MEAN
Mu = POPULATION MEAN
n= sample size
N= POPULATION SIZE
The sum of the deviations from the mean is always equal to 0.
The mean will always be pulled towards any outliers.
Ex: the average price of similar televisions at different stores. This is quantitative data that does not have outliers since the TVs at the different stores are similar
